Freeport, Grand Bahama – Grand Bahama
Power Company (GBPC) Board of Directors recently decided to defer the dividend
normally paid in the second quarter of the year, which resulted in ICDU not
paying its customary July
dividendfor 2009.
Wayne Crawley, President and CEO of ICDU noted, “GBPC executives felt it
would be prudent to defer dividends which would have been normally paid to ICDU.”
E. O. Ferrell, President and
CEO of GBPC stated “The Board of Directors determined that the current decline
in electricity sales due to the slow economy, coupled with the financial
uncertainties of hurricane season, made it imperative that the company conserve
its cash reserves at this time.” A
decision regarding the timing of the dividend payment will be made later in the
year.
Ferrell also noted that GBPC took similar
action in the past after the devastating effects of two major hurricanes on
Grand Bahama. “Grand Bahama Power
Company is focused on improving the overall reliability of the system and the
long term results of the company.”
